python如何登录带滑动验证的

python如何登录带滑动验证的

作者:Rhett Bai发布时间:2026-01-13阅读时长:0 分钟阅读次数:11

用户关注问题

Q
如何自动化处理Python中的滑动验证码?

在使用Python自动化登录时,遇到滑动验证码,如何才能有效识别并通过该验证?

A

利用图像识别技术解决滑动验证码

可以使用Python中的图像处理库(如OpenCV)检测滑动验证码的缺口位置,然后模拟鼠标滑动动作完成验证。通过比较完整图片和带缺口图片的差异,计算出缺口坐标,再结合selenium或pyautogui实现滑动效果。

Q
有哪些Python库可以辅助实现滑动验证码的自动登录?

在编写Python脚本登录需要滑动验证码的网站时,通常会用到哪些第三方库来识别和模拟滑动操作?

A

常用的图像处理与自动化操作库

常用的库有OpenCV用于图像识别,selenium用于浏览器自动化操作,pyautogui可以模拟鼠标拖动,这些库结合使用能较好地实现滑动验证码的自动完成。

Q
使用Python破解滑动验证码有哪些注意事项?

在用Python脚本绕过滑动验证码登录时,应该注意哪些可能影响成功率的问题?

A

防止被反爬机制检测和模拟人类行为

滑动验证码通常设计用以防止自动登录,脚本需要模拟真实用户的滑动轨迹以避免被检测,适当加入滑动速度和轨迹随机性。同时还要注意频率限制及IP封禁等反爬机制,避免短时间内反复尝试导致账号被封。